Plasticity

ability to be molded

stress formula

stress = force/area

shear stress

A measure of how easily a material can be twisted.

tensile strength

A measure of how much stress from pulling, or tension, a material can withstand before breaking.

Young's Modulus

A measure of the stiffness of an elastic material and defined by stress/strain.

Shear Modulus

A term describing a solid's resistance to shear stress, denoted by the letter S and measured by the ratio of shear stress (F/A) to strain (x/h).

what do the following letters stand for: F, K, x, W?

F: force K: spring constant / spring stiffness d or x: extension W: work done

Formula for Hooke's Law

F=kx k is the spring constant, units (Nm^-1)

Define Hooke's Law (2)

Hooke's Law states that the increase in length of a spring is directly proportional to the force pulling on it. If stretched beyond the elastic limit, the spring will not return to its original length.

what is stress and strain?

Stress - force applied per unit area Strain - deformation produced by stress

yield point (elastic limit)

point on the load deformation curve past which deformation is permanent

Young's modulus formula

stress/strain

resilience

the amount of deformation required to bring a material to its elastic limit

elastic limit

the maximum extent to which a solid may be stretched without permanent alteration of size or shape.

rigidity

the physical property of being stiff and resisting bending

volume stress

the stress that causes bulk deformation
